Verb: proffer  pró-fu(r)
  1. Present for acceptance or rejection
    "She proffered us all a cold drink";
    - offer
Noun: proffer  pró-fu(r)
  1. A proposal offered for acceptance or rejection
    "The company made a proffer of employment to the talented candidate";
    - suggestion, proposition

Derived forms: proffered, proffering, proffers

Type of: give, proposal
